Parkersburg South won the last time they faced Buckhannon-Upshur and things went their way on Saturday too. The Parkersburg South Patriots came out on top against the Buckhannon-Upshur Buccaneers by a score of 62-52.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Patriots.

When it comes to explaining why Buckhannon-Upshur lost, don't look at Alyssa Abel. Despite the final result, she dropped a double-double with 22 points and 12 rebounds. Abel's afternoon made it three games in a row in which she has scored at least 15 points. The team also got some help courtesy of Harley Dean, who posted 11 points.

Parkersburg South's win bumped their record up to 6-14. As for Buckhannon-Upshur, they have traveled a rocky road recently having lost three of their last four matchups. That's put a noticeable dent in their 8-10 record this season.

Parkersburg South is taking a road trip to square off against Morgantown at 1:45 p.m. on Saturday. As for Buckhannon-Upshur, they did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 62-41 loss against Lewis County on the 18th.
